Originally released in 1923. The Eternal Struggle is a crime/drama film. directed by Reginald Barker. At just 77 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Renée Adorée, Earle Williams, and Barbara La Marr
Synopsis
Believing she's responsible for the death of her would-be seducer, a young woman flees to North Vancouver.
